Key Facts

  • Infleqtion to open Oxford Quantum Innovation Centre, expanding UK ops.
  • Centre will triple UK research, production, and systems integration capacity.
  • Delivered UK's first 100-qubit computer to NQCC, meeting 2025 target.
  • Royal Navy Tiqker optical clock trials aboard Excalibur; more trials planned.
  • Aligned with UK National Quantum Strategy and ProQure program.
